About Pradan Foundation

Pradan Foundation is a non-government organization established on 2 August 2010 in Hazaribagh, Jharkhand, working across all districts of the state for the welfare and development of underprivileged communities. The organization was founded with the aim of creating awareness, empowering rural people, and strengthening the connection between communities and government services. Since its inception, Pradan Foundation has been actively working in the areas of education, health, women empowerment, child rights, sustainable livelihood, skill development, water sanitation, and hygiene, and disaster management.

The organization believes that knowledge and awareness are the foundation of self-development and social transformation. Through community participation and grassroots engagement, Pradan Foundation works to empower vulnerable groups, especially women, children, tribal communities, and economically weaker families. By collaborating with government departments, non-government organizations, and local communities, the organization strives to create sustainable development, equal opportunities, and a better future for all.
